The very first element of that path?ย Creating visibility. Visibility isnโt something you suddenly do when youโre ready for a new job. Itโs something you nurtureย all the time. Over the years, I canโt count how many people have come to meโlaid off, burned out, or ready for something newโand said, “I shouldโve been building my visibility all along.” What Visibilityย Reallyย MeansVisibility isnโt about putting yourself in the spotlight. Itโs aboutย sharing your light. Itโs about being of service, giving value, and allowing others toย seeย your gifts. When you reframe visibility this wayโas an act of generosity and contributionโit feels more authentic. And it becomes a practice youโll want to keep up regularly, not just when you’re in need. Why We Wait Too LongMost people donโt start building visibility until something shakes up their career: - A layoff
- A promotion that never comes
- An approaching empty nest or retirement
- Or just that quiet voice saying, โI want more than this.โ
And when that moment comes, many feel awkward reaching out, because they havenโt kept up those connections. They say things like: “I donโt want to ask for something now when I havenโt talked to them in years.” Thatโs why regret #2 is so painful.ย Because itโs avoidable. The New Habit to BuildHereโs what I want you to know: - When you are visible, you donโt just serve yourself โฆ you serve others.
- When you consistently show up and shine your light, you create opportunities for people to find you. Maybe about a job opportunity or maybe to ask for your advice and wisdom.
- And when a need arisesโa team member to mentor, a job to fill, a speaker to book, a board seat to fillโyouโre already in the mix.
Youโre not scrambling to show upโฆ Youโve been showing up all along. The key is to findย visibility vehicles that energize youโnot drain youโand commit to showing up in those spaces regularly. Because the result is twofold: - Others know who you are and what you offer.
- And you feel more confident asking for what you need, because youโve already been giving, connecting, and contributing all along.
